A question many clients ask is:

"What is a termination clause, and why should it be included in my contracts?" 📝🚪 #TerminationClause #ContractExit

Answer: 📝
A termination clause is a provision in a contract that outlines the conditions under which one or both parties can end the agreement before its completion. It specifies the reasons for termination, the process, and any penalties or obligations that apply when the contract is terminated early. Think of it as the “escape route” in case things don’t go as planned. 🚪💼

For example, if you're entering into a service agreement with a vendor, a termination clause might allow you to end the contract if the vendor fails to meet agreed performance standards or if circumstances change. This protects your business from being stuck in unfavorable agreements. 🔑

📌 Top Benefits of a Termination Clause:

  • Flexibility: Provides you with the option to end the agreement if things aren't working out, offering more control over the relationship.
  • Clear Exit Strategy: Helps avoid potential confusion or disputes about how and when the contract can be terminated.
  • Protects Your Interests: Ensures that you're not locked into an agreement that no longer suits your business needs or goals.
  • Minimizes Penalties: Allows you to terminate the contract without facing excessive penalties, as long as the conditions for termination are met. ⚖️

#ContractExit #BusinessFlexibility

💡 Why Should Clients Care?
Without a termination clause, your business might be bound to a contract that no longer aligns with your goals or needs, leading to financial and operational strain. A termination clause ensures you have an exit plan. 🛑💼 #BusinessSecurity #LegalProtection

Pro Tip: Be specific in the termination clause about the grounds for termination, the notice period, and the consequences to avoid misunderstandings. ✅
